Implantable contact lenses, also known as ICLs, are a popular alternative to LA Lasik surgery. ICLs are tiny plastic or silicone lenses inserted inside the eye, behind the cornea. These lenses bend the incoming light rays and can correct a very wide range of nearsightedness.
